The whole £1bn spend is a bit of a misnomer.  City gave Everton £50m for Stones.  Everton gave £30m of that to  Palace for Balassie.  Palace then gave that straight to Liverpool for Benteke.  Liverpool gave £30m + to Southampton for Mane.  So that's about 10% of the total spend accounted for just by City giving Everton money for Stones!  They are basically playing pass the parcel with exorbitant sums of money!
